Check out the new Kitchen collection by McGuire! The natural wood and wicker furniture pieces are gorgeous (and so are the images!). The collection is made up of 21 new pieces and includes 3 tables and 11 chairs and 7 counter stools.

These beautiful chairs are created by designers Johannes Gille and Jos Kranen from The Netherlands. The roots of these chair, namedForest Chair, can be found within the “Volkskunst” a typical style witch developed itself over hundreds of years between the mountains of Tirol, Austria. Khai Liew is a furniture designer, based in Adelaide, Australia, who creates the most gorgeous wooden furniture pieces. Liew’s design rhetoric is informed by a number of historical and cultural influences. The straight line dominates his design process, leading to geometric, rectilinear furniture.
